Output 28696094d00876debd64df204863573ca338c5acbd0408d006ac5efb928f3bf3:1

value
6177009
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6a6bee5d22faef7cbd5928d3a692bcd3ce8073b8 OP_EQUALVERIFY OP_CHECKSIG
address
1AhhvX6f9D5WmLTLiEbECouHwvYR5Qaa1h
transaction
28696094d00876debd64df204863573ca338c5acbd0408d006ac5efb928f3bf3
spent
true